After a groundbreaking preliminary phase, featuring a record number of clubs and National Federations across Europe, the eight clubs (four men`s and four women`s) that will compete for continental supremacy at the CEV Beach Volley European Cup Final in early November in Heraklion, Greece, have now been determined.

Clubs from 12 National Federations are still in contention for continental honours.

Men`s Competition

In the men`s category, the qualifying groups saw C.S.U. Resita (Romania), Montpellier Beach Volley (France), Aloha Beachvolleyball Club (Austria), BC Strahov (Czechia), ZVH Zevenhuizen (Netherlands), and Sunrise Beach Sports Academy (Ukraine) secure their spots. They will be joined by the host nation`s representative, 4 Sports Club Athens, and Ré Beach Club (France), who advanced as the highest-ranked runner-up from the preliminary phase.

Women`s Competition

For the women`s competition, Beograd Beach Volley (Serbia), KBC Oxyklinika (Lithuania), CV Majadahonda (Spain), Ré Beach Club (France), Edra Tata (Hungary), and Sunrise Beach Sports Academy (Ukraine) emerged as group leaders. The final spots in the eight-team field are filled by 4 Sports Club Athens (Greece) and BVC Ludus Ljubljana (Slovenia), with the latter securing their place as the highest-ranked second-placed team across all pools. Notably, BVC Ludus are former champions, having claimed the inaugural CEV Beach Volley European Cup title in Balikesir, Türkiye, in 2023.

The Final will be taking place in early November (6-9) in an idyllic setting in Heraklion, Greece.

The upcoming Final in Heraklion will feature clubs from an impressive 12 National Federations, offering a unique platform for teams to showcase their talent, compete internationally, and demonstrate their collective strength – as the competition format emphasizes team performance over individual brilliance. Since its establishment in 2023, the CEV Beach Volley European Cup has steadily gained momentum and prestige. Heraklion provides an ideal setting for this grand finale, where players and coaches are eagerly preparing to conclude the 2025 Beach Volleyball season in memorable fashion.
